Diaphragm Area and Mass Nonlinearities of Cone Loudspeakers

Document Thumbnail

In the investigation of mechanical parameter nonlinearities of low-frequency loudspeakers with single-roll suspension, a systematic variation of the mass with diaphragm position has been revealed. The variation turns out to be associated with a variation in the effective area of the diaphragm. The variations are described and documented, and some consequences of the variations are discussed. The work presented is a part of the Danish LoDist project.
